The Operations Business Analyst provides detailed and summary reporting to assist in the monitoring of the quality, processing timeliness and regulatory compliance. The Analyst works with a cross-functional team to design, plan, develop and implement initiatives around both new and existing processes and identifies and executes on strategies to improve workflow through automation and/or enhanced reporting. This position collaborates with various business units across the company, including leadership, to translate business needs into strategies and plans with focused execution. Job Responsibilities

Provides detailed and summary reporting to assist in the monitoring of the quality, processing timeliness and regulatory compliance Works with a cross-functional team in planning, developing and implementing initiatives around both new and existing processes Identifies and executes on strategies to improve workflow through automation and/or enhanced reporting Partners directly with business owners to implement solutions to process defects Creates task plans and action items for tracking projects, timeline adherence, and follow-ups with business units Manages and executes a schedule of daily, weekly and monthly reports to provide detail and summary reports for the purpose of monitoring the work of the processing vendor Develops, runs and quality controls ad-hoc reports as requested Builds and maintains relationships with key individuals within the organization business teams and use these relationships to align needs within the department and initiate process changes Analyzes internal practices, understands the business risk management needs, and research both internal and external solutions for process improvements Develops, maintains and monitors reporting to support department leadership in the areas of staffing requirements, work‑force management, productivity statistics and other key metrics utilized in running the business unit Maintains working knowledge of departmental processes and procedures to identify opportunities for process improvements that result in efficiency gains, cost savings and/or risk mitigation, and work with management/staff to implement approved initiatives Keeps abreast of developments within the broad area of IT and looks for opportunities to apply them to the company/department goals Provides daily, weekly, and monthly updates to management, as necessary Assists with project support in reporting, root cause analytics, process mapping, and tracking/reporting of results Appropriately assess risk when business decisions are made, include but not limited to compliance and operational risk.
